  • Heading down the river from Sauk City to Boscobel. Just shy of 60mi trip. Three days, two nights. Wisconsin was/is having an incredibly dry year, the river was very low and barely moving. What was supposed to be an enjoyable fishing cruise ended up being more or less a paddling marathon to stay on schedule. Video is mostly visuals of the trip and camp sites.     I am watching your video but just read description. Water was low and not moving... is that uncommon for that river ... it seems pretty wide. is it a slow moving river normally? We are looking to plan for our trip for next year...

      Hey Hans, usually the river moves at about 3-4mph. We figured it was moving at about 1-1.5mph. We had a very unusual dry spring and early summer this past year that led to the low river. This just meant more paddling than expected. We still did about 60mi in 2.5 days.

      Matt, unfortunately, I'm not sure. We didn't use a shuttle service. We drove my buddies truck to the end and then drove mine to the start point. There were/are a bunch of outfitters along the way. I'm sure a Google search would get you to where you need to go "Wisconsin river outfitters". I'd just recommend planning on stopping earlier rather than later. We were in a rush so had to paddle long days due to the slow flow. Every time we wanted to stop we kept finding people in the locations we planned to. So start looking earlier in the afternoon, don't wait until you need to.
